As I moved to the next floor, I felt intense heat prickling my skin.

Inhaling, the heat seared my throat and warmed my lungs.

Taking a calm, deep breath and opening my eyes, the first thing I saw was cracked land, as if ravaged by a drought.

There wasn’t a single rock in sight, and ash falling from the sky obscured the sun, making the surroundings dark despite the lack of clouds.

And finally, far in the distance.

At the edge of my vision, I saw an active volcano spewing black smoke.

– Welcome to the 21st floor trial.

– Theme: Shaking Earth

– Time Limit: 24 hours

– You have arrived in a volcanic zone where intense heat stimulates the skin.

– Advance towards the volcano with your companion and escape the unstable earth.

The 21st floor trial.

The trials from the 21st to 30th floors involve navigating natural phenomena, trials known as natural disasters.

The difficulty is significantly higher than the trials at the beginning of the tower, which simply involved crossing rivers and climbing mountains.

The theme of the first trial is Shaking Earth.

As the description says to escape the ‘unstable earth,’ the disaster of this trial is…

Kugugugu!

An earthquake.

‘This was a section where I could freely use the Guidebook of the Journey.’

Unfortunately, I couldn’t get help from the Guidebook of the Journey right now.

The Guidebook of the Journey, which had been reset through regression, hadn’t returned even after time had passed.

I thought it might be a penalty for using Chronos’ Hourglass [a mythical artifact that can rewind time].

‘More than that, a companion.’

Even if it were someone else, it would be better for Seun to proceed with the trial alone.

In the Diablo Clan, Yuseo-ah was the only one who could keep up with Seun’s speed.

No, Park Jung-pil had grown a lot recently, too.

‘Still, not that guy.’

Of course, this theme wouldn’t end with just one floor.

To be with Park Jung-pil for several floors like that…

The thought alone made me dizzy.

I wondered if it would be more comfortable to knock him unconscious and drag him around so he couldn’t say anything.

After a moment, a ‘companion’ appeared next to Seun in a flash of white light.

As soon as he saw the figure, Seun cursed.

“Damn…”

“Ugh, it’s hot. Huh? Hyungniiiiim!”

Of all people, it was that guy.

* * *

“Wow, I lived! I was so nervous that the little kid might get caught again this time!”

“Haa…”

Little kid.

He probably meant Han Areum.

If Han Areum had been chosen as a companion, I could have at least carried her on my back.

‘Should I really knock him out?’

I thought about the plan I had jokingly considered again.

Of course, if I were just going to quickly pass one trial, that might be more comfortable, but I couldn’t do that.

I couldn’t keep carrying him on my back for several floors.

Kugugu-

While I was hesitating, the vibration of the earth grew even stronger.

“Follow me.”

“Yes!”

Perhaps because of the harsh ‘education’ and ‘training’ he had been repeating recently, he followed Seun without asking questions.

Besides, Park Jung-pil is the fastest runner in the Diablo Clan after Yuseo-ah.

His evasion skills are also excellent, so he won’t fall behind or be hit by environmental hazards caused by the earthquake.

It was a blessing in disguise?

‘If he gets in the way later, I’ll really have to knock him out.’

I hoped that such a situation wouldn’t arise.

Kugugugu!

“Uwaaah! Hyungnim, be careful! The ground is wriggling!”

“I’ll leave you behind if you’re late, so keep up.”

“L, let’s go together! Hyungniiim!”

Looking at the twisting earth, I immediately moved my legs.

The spot where I had been standing a moment ago was grotesquely distorted and cracked open, trembling as if regretting missing its prey.

If Yuseo-ah’s footwork was like a well-honed technique learned from Seun, Park Jung-pil’s footwork was like watching a puppy running around in a hurry.

He screamed, ‘Uwaaah!’ as he jumped over the splitting ground or dodged rocks that suddenly popped out, rolling on the floor.

It was funny to watch, but the amazing thing was that he was perfectly avoiding all those hazards.

– The constellation, ‘Donkey-Headed Snatcher,’ points at the contractor and laughs loudly, telling him to look at that sight.

Confirming that he was keeping up, Seun increased his speed.

– Through inner energy [cultivation energy], the movement of Chosangbi becomes even faster.

Thanks to Chosangbi, which had become familiar after passing through swamps and snowfields, Seun’s steps were as fast as the wind.

As unstable as the earth was, there was also a way to spread Icarus’ Wings [magical wings], but that consumed too much mana [magical energy].

The destination of this trial was quite far, so it was impossible to move to the destination by flying.

If I carried Park Jung-pil with me, the mana consumption would jump not only twice but three or four times.

– The constellation, ‘Hungry Prince,’ busily looks around for something to eat.

Beelzebub was making a fuss, but the trials up to the 30th floor were mostly about testing the player’s survival skills through natural disasters.

It wasn’t a trial centered around monsters like the swamp.

That being said, monsters would occasionally appear, but they wouldn’t feed him as much as before.

Of course.

‘If you look for it, there are quite a few ‘special meals’ too.’

This is a unique trial, so there are unique monsters.

For example, monsters in a similar position to the ‘antlion’ I encountered in the desert trial.

However, the problem was that I couldn’t know its location without the Guidebook of the Journey, but at least as far as the monster Seun was aiming for now, there was no need to worry about that.

Kugugugu-

Unlike the antlion, the monsters here were the type to openly reveal themselves.

“Geeeeeeee-!!”

Far away, the unusually shaking earth exploded as if an explosion had occurred.

A monster made of earth appeared from within.

“H, Hyungnim! Look at that! Isn’t the level of monsters getting ridiculously stronger? That’s not just a beast, it’s a mega-beast!”

Volcanic golem.

It was the boss monster here.

Of course, even though it was a boss monster, there was no need to hunt it.

The setting was that it would stay fixed in that spot, shaking the earth and causing earthquakes.

Unless you got close to it, you wouldn’t be directly attacked.

Although you had to go around a bit, the intensity of the earthquake would decrease if you moved as far away from it as possible.

Looking at it, Seun immediately changed direction.

“H, Hyungnim? Where are you going?”

Not in the opposite direction, but in the direction where the Volcanic Golem had risen.

– The constellation, ‘Hungry Prince,’ packs his tableware, saying he knew he could trust you.

– The constellation, ‘Hungry Prince,’ is looking forward to what kind of food it will taste like this time.

– The constellation, ‘Donkey-Headed Snatcher,’ cannot help but laugh as he watches the contractor in a panic.

“J, just a moment. Hyungnim! Think again! That’s ridiculous!”

“Then go separately by yourself.”

“Ah, that’s a bit! Ah, ah! I understand, so let’s go a little slower!”

The Volcanic Golem, visible in the distance, began to tear at the ground in earnest.

It lifted both hands high and slammed them down, or twisted its body to distort the surrounding earth.

The rough earthquakes occurred around it and spread quickly.

Jjeok!

Kugugugu!

The ground suddenly popped out, or huge scars appeared.

If you let your guard down even a little, your body would be pierced or you would fall into the abyss.

“Geeeeeeee-!!”

Kuuung!

As the golem struck the ground, a huge stone wall popped out in front of Seun.

It seemed like a silent pressure not to approach him any further.

There was no gap to escape, and the height was ridiculously high to jump over, but Seun had no intention of going around in the first place.

Seun drew Durendal [his sword].

If there is no way, just make one.

There was no need to go all the way around when there was a shortcut right in front of me.

– Through inner energy, the sixth form of the Taesan Eighteen Swordsmanship, Taesan Yangbun (泰山兩分) [Splitting Mount Taesan], is enhanced.

– According to the mysteries of the Breaking Heart Skill, the power of martial arts is enhanced.

If the fifth form of the Taesan Eighteen Swordsmanship, Taesan Apjeong [Pressing Down on Mount Taesan], had the power to press down on the mountain, then the next form, Taesan Yangbun, was an upward slash with the power to split Taesan in two.

Because it was a greatsword that placed extreme importance on power, it was a swordsmanship that was impossible to perform without superhuman strength beyond human limits before inner energy.

It was a form that I was able to use thanks to the greatly amplified strength by using the ‘Black Ogre’s Tendon’ recently.

Kwagwagwagwa!

It wasn’t a cutting sound.

With rough and crude sound effects, as if firing cannons at a cliff, the stone wall cracked open to both sides.

It wasn’t just the stone wall that was like that, but the ground in front of Seun was also deeply dug in.

A scar created solely by swordsmanship, not an earthquake.

Through it, I met the red eyes of the Volcanic Golem.

“Geeeeeeee-!!”

The same cry as the first time, without a single change in tone, as befitting a golem.

Perhaps that was not a sound being uttered through intelligence, but simply a tone inputted to drive away intruders.

It was a noise that was deafening, but I ignored it and ran towards the gap I had just created.

Kung, Kugukung!

Stone pillars rose from all sides.

As if proving the name Volcanic Golem, the stone pillars were not just simple stones but contained red lava.

While the intense heat stung my skin as if it would cook it, Seun ran firmly towards the golem.

Since the distance was quite far, many stone pillars were created in the meantime.

The floor was already impossible to step on due to the lava flowing down from the stone pillars.

There were dense stone pillars blocking the way, but it was too wasteful to destroy them all.

Thinking so, Seun felt the vibration of the floor and ran diagonally.

Then…

Kugugugu!

The floor where Seun was standing rose sharply. He had predicted the location where the stone pillars would rise and taken his position.

The golem noticed this and stopped the stone pillars, but it was already too late.

Seun stepped on the stone pillars in front of him like stepping stones and approached him.

‘Was the Volcanic Golem’s weakness water?’

As befitting a golem, he was a monster with tremendous resistance to physical attacks.

Just like when I faced the Ice Golem before, if I poked at the gaps, I would rather allow a counterattack with lava erupting through them.

Then, a new weapon I had recently obtained came to mind.

‘It’s the first debut.’

Seun drew the chillingly cold ice bow, the Undying Bow.

I had used it as a demonstration in the ice lake before, but that was only for practice or confirmation.

This was the first time using it in actual combat.

Geudeudeuk!

Pulling the bowstring with all my might, I jumped up from my spot.

The golem aimed at Seun and threw red boulders like a catapult, but it was useless.

This was because Icarus’ Wings fluttered and guided Seun to a higher place.

– The Vault of Greed has been opened.

[ Wriggling Bow, Nokha ]

– A treasure passed down through generations to the Nagarajas [snake deities], the kings who rule the Nagas [serpentine beings], who are called the half-human, half-snake race.

Moisture swirled around the Undying Bow.

The power of Nagaraja’s bow, Nokha, was imbued in the Undying Bow, creating a water arrow that wriggled like a snake instead of the usual ice arrow.

From here, there was no need to worry any further.

I simply released the arrow that was wriggling as if it wanted to devour its prey right away.

Pyiung-

The water arrow, shot almost perpendicularly from the air.

It increased in size as it went down, taking on the shape of a giant sea serpent.

The sight was like watching an Imoogi [a proto-dragon] who had failed to ascend and was falling to the ground.

The Imoogi found an existence to unleash its anger at not becoming a dragon.

Kyaaaak-!

It opened its ferocious mouth and revealed the rough whirlpool existing inside its throat.

The golem crossed its arms and lowered its posture to block the attack, but it was useless.

The Imoogi’s maw, which had come down to the top of the golem’s head, had already surpassed the golem’s size.

Swaaaaaaaa-!!

The 21st trial.

A waterfall poured down onto the shaking earth.
